Description
- Brett Whiteley
- SOUTHERLY COMING
- Signed and inscribed with title lower right; the artist's studio stamp lower left
- Watercolour on paper
- 41.5 by 57 cm
Provenance
Baker Galleries, Sydney (label on the reverse)
Private collection, Sydney
Private collection, Sydney
Condition
Contemporary gold frame with white mount. Paper appears to have yellowed - visable along the top and bottom of the work against the mount. Good condition.

Catalogue Note
Since Dada and Surrealism, the element of chance has been a significant part of the vocabulary of modern art. Brett Whiteley here demonstrates his particular embrace of the aleatory, in a work which takes its character and title from a pale explosion of brush water in the upper left. The subject of the present work is the familiar view from Whiteley's Lavender Bay house and studio: over a foreground of palms, pier and yachts, past Luna Park to the Bridge and across the Harbour to the city. Either by the acceptance or adaptation of an accident, or possibly by deliberate, anarchic gesture, Whiteley makes a splash with his counter sunburst of nasty weather, drip rays running towards Lavender Bay pier like needles of wind.
